See Riverside Party Bus Prices Online
Riverside party bus rental prices shift based on the vehicle size, the day of the week, and how many hours you need. As a planning baseline: a minibus runs roughly $200–$275 per hour on weekdays and $200–$275 on weekends, while a 25-passenger party bus typically runs $250–$350 per hour on weekdays and $275–$375 on weekends. A full 56-passenger charter bus generally falls in the $200–$350 per hour range either way.
Per-day rates for a party bus range from around $1,400 to over $4,000 depending on the vehicle and the date.

How far is Riverside from Temecula wine country, and what's the best bus for that route?
Temecula's Rancho California Road wine corridor is roughly 35 miles from downtown Riverside — about 40–50 minutes on the 215 South depending on weekend traffic near Murrieta. A 20- to 30-passenger party bus is the most popular pick for wine country day trips from Riverside: enough room for the full group, comfortable on the freeway stretch, and sized right for the winery parking lots along De Portola Road and Rancho California Road. For larger groups of 40+, a charter bus works — just confirm your planned winery stops when requesting your quote, since some smaller vineyard lots have restrictions on large vehicle access.

How far in advance should I book a party bus in Riverside?
For most events — birthday nights, wine tours, airport transfers — two to four weeks of lead time is workable. For high-demand windows, book much earlier: prom season (book by January–February), Temecula wine festival weekends (book 6–8 weeks out), Mission Inn Festival of Lights events (book 2–3 months out), and major concerts at Glen Helen or NOS Events Center (book as soon as the event is announced). Waiting until the week before almost always means higher rates or no availability on the vehicle you want.

California Citrus State Historic Park
California Citrus State Historic Park (9400 Dufferin Ave, Riverside, CA 92504) is a 248-acre working heritage citrus grove and museum site that tells the story of Riverside's role in establishing California's citrus industry — the navel orange was commercially introduced here in the 1870s. The park is a popular destination for school field trips, family events, and photography groups, and its parking lot along Dufferin Avenue accommodates vehicles but has limited space for simultaneous large-group arrivals. The park grounds are open daily, 8am–5pm (weekends extend to 7pm in summer), with the visitor center and museum open Friday through Sunday, 10am–4pm; vehicle day-use admission is $7, with bus and limo day-use rates of $50 for 10–24 passengers and $100 for 25 or more.
For charter bus groups: the Dufferin Avenue entrance is the correct approach from the 91 East via Central Avenue. Check current hours and group tour availability at the official California State Parks page before your visit.
